It's kinda cool to stand on the ground where Sacajawea, Lewis & Clark and Corps of Discovery camped over 200 years ago. Heritage days takes place Sept. 28-29. There will be Lewis & Clark reenactments, Mountain Men, Native Americans, wood carvers, a steam engine, birds of prey and more.It's a free event, but you'll need a Discover Pass or pay a $10 daily park entrance fee.
